Output fc91fdc8bb7913426dc5d4600bec9670d7a68ec7146a2d2420dcde6039785754:1

value
25924324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a34648ea50f3584edec57184852bc3fee8b114b OP_EQUAL
address
39uyW89whkXyHRc6iJ2qXTVhBq5vX3AzUV
transaction
fc91fdc8bb7913426dc5d4600bec9670d7a68ec7146a2d2420dcde6039785754
spent
true